Can't play Colonization in Vista...

A have a (ahem) copy of Colonization that I'd been happily playing on my 3 year old XP computer for several years, problem free. I recently bought a new PC with Vista; after copying over all the relevant files, my new machine steadfastly refuses to open Colonization. Instead, I'm given the error message "C:\Windows\system32\cmd.exe; This system does not support fullscreen mode." I'm then directed to close the program. I get the same error message when attempting to reinstall.

I'm beginning to worry that I'll never again know the pleasure of paying the Tupi to burn British villages. Help me, AskMetafilter!
